Decision time on Dumb, Drunk & Racist

Four visitors are quizzed on their positions but first there's a B&S ball to attend in Meandarra.

This week on Dumb, Drunk & Racist the four visiting Indians are asked for their verdict.

There’s a bbq discussion about whether we are or aren’t any of the above, and the conclusions certainly put a little perspective on things.

But first the episode tackles our nation’s love affair with alcohol consumption via a B&S Ball in Meandarra – and it’s not pretty.

After a three-week road trip, the Indians’ Australian odyssey is nearly at an end. But before they reveal their views on Australia, they take a look at our drinking culture…

Australians drink more than just about any other country on earth; we also love our cricket. Joe introduces the Indians to a grand tradition – a beer at the cricket.

The crew then embark on a club crawl in Surfers Paradise, and experience Aussie binge drinking culture up close. Binge drinking is one of the major health problems affecting young Australians and it’s the police and hospital emergency departments that are on the frontline. Joe takes Amer and Radhika to St Vincent’s, where Dr Gordian Fulde reveals that a single drunken punch can destroy a life.

From the city, the Indians then head to the bush to experience a country pub. Wrapping up the drinking tour, Joe takes everyone to the Meandarra B&S Ball, a romantic rite of passage where alcohol plays a vital role.

Finally, after meeting and experiencing many different parts of the Australian culture, Gurmeet, Radhika, Amer and Mahima deliver their verdict. How have their opinions changed? Do they still believe Australians are indeed dumb, drunk and racist?
